Rewrite the quadratic function in intercept or factored form<br> y=-40x+2x^2-2x
poizon [28]

Answer:

y = 2x(x - 21)

Step-by-step explanation:

The given quadratic function y = -40x + 2x^2 - 2x

This can be rearranged as

y = 2x^2 - 2x - 40x

Here the Greatest Common Factor is 2x, we can take it out and write the remaining term in parenthesis.

y = 2x(x - 1 -20)

y = 2x(x - 21)
